ALL 24 Music Keys flow in perfect sequence  according to the CIRCLE of FIFTHS .
Journey to the Key of C is composed in an arpeggiated finger style for the piano. A MUST for learning the piano. The FULL SPECTRUM  of ALL 24 keys flow in logical beautiful listening order.
To know ALL Keys is a music for any pianist/musician and this is a fabulous way to learn ALL the 24 keys flowing alternating  from minor to major and ending up in the key of C Major. Convenient Chord symbols included.
